For optimal performance in this cozy multiplayer life sim, an entry-level GPU like the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is recommended. These graphics cards are capable of handling the game’s vibrant environments and casual gameplay without much strain. Players with these GPUs can expect smooth performance at 1080p on medium settings, allowing for a pleasant experience while exploring biomes and engaging in various activities.
For those on slightly older or less powerful systems, you can still enjoy the game with integrated graphics or older GPUs, but expect to lower the resolution to 720p and set the graphics to low to maintain a playable frame rate. Overall, the game is designed to be accessible, making it a great choice for players who want a relaxing experience without needing high-end hardware.
